  3. 3. PitchBob

    AI pitch deck generator

    Best for: Getting one investor deck out the door fast · Price: Per-deck / credit packs

    Fast for a single deck. The numbers and story come from a form you fill, not from validated research — and the deck is where it ends.

  4. 4. Upmetrics AI

    AI business planning

    Best for: AI-assisted formal business plans with financial forecasts · Price: From ~$7/mo (annual)

    Strong AI-assisted planning if the plan document is your deliverable — lenders and grant applications love it. Doesn't extend into legal, HR, or fundraising execution.

  5. 5. FounderPal

    AI marketing tools

    Best for: Solo founders who need quick marketing strategy and copy · Price: Free tools; paid bundles

    A likeable set of free marketing generators (personas, marketing ideas, copy). Marketing-only — pair it with other tools for the rest of the company.

Can AI tools really replace consultants and lawyers for startups?

They replace the drafting and analysis stage — market sizing, first-draft legal documents, financial models — at a fraction of the cost. For final legal review or complex tax work you still want a professional; Founders360 even includes a vetted partner network for exactly that handoff.
